Requirements
-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ited university and 7 years Finance/Business Management work experience or 5 years with a Masters.
- Extensive knowledge of Earned Value Management Systems (EVMS) and financial analysis
- Working knowledge of EVMS Software (i.e. MPM or Cobra), SAP, Microsoft Office Suite and Accounting principles
- The willingness and ability to travel domestically 10% of the time
- Experience developing and presenting business strategies, financial information, and risk assessments to leadership teams
- Ability to obtain and maintain a secret clearance.
Responsibilities
- Provide direct supervision activities, including completion of performance goals and reviews, assigning work scope to employees, reviewing and approving timecards, and ensuring employees operate according to company policies and procedures.
- Develop employee skills and evaluate employee performance on assigned responsibilities, including: EVMS implementation and analysis; support and guidance to PMs and CAMs; analysis and preparation of cost and schedule reports; development, analysis and review of EACs; variance analysis research and reporting; and reconciliations to SAP.
- Support customer Integrated Baseline Reviews (IBR), Supplier Integrated Baseline Reviews (IBR), and Defense Contract Management Agency (DCMA) Joint Surveillance Reviews (JSR) audits
- Responsible for ensuring contract deliverables are completed and submitted on a timely manner (CFSR, CSDR, IPMR, CWBS)
- Focus team on achieving uncompromising quality in all products and services, accountability and team performance.
- Ensure team fully understands their roles and impact on financial results.
- Act as the primary interface with the program office, functional leadership, and external auditing agencies regarding EVMS related tasks/efforts, requirements, issues, analysis, and performance measures.
- Support proposal preparation, fact-finding and contract negotiations as needed to ensure cost management issues are represented.
- Act as primary point of contact with customer counterpart, and maintain a positive working relationship to improve communication and stay on top of any potential cost issues.
- Perform in a fast paced, frequently changing, and demand driven environment
